The 5As is a tool that promotes jointly set goals that are assessable, aspirational, aligned, accountable, and agile – the 5 As. 5As method collaboratively approaches performance management. This method accounts for the complex needs of today’s goal-setting process and rapidly evolves through collaboration.

Performance management is the process of maintaining or improving employee job performance through the use of performance assessment tools, coaching and counseling as well as providing continuous ...Jan 28, 2022 · Modern methods of performance management focus on people and potential. Instead of looking backward and chastising an employee for something that happened as long as a year ago, modern methods look ahead to improve strengths and overcome weaknesses in daily performance. New processes are fluid and fit into the daily flow of work.

List of 11 performance management techniques. This section lists 11 performance management techniques: 1. Performance appraisals. Performance appraisals allow managers to judge the overall performance of junior colleagues over a 3 to 12 month testing period. Performance management process steps. The steps in the performance management process can be broken down into four broad categories: Planning, coaching, reviewing and rewarding. Each step is equally important, and together form the backbone of a company’s performance management process. 1.

The performance management cycle is a part of the performance management process or strategy, it is shorter and utilizes a continuous four-step procedure of planning, monitoring, reviewing and rewarding. However, online gaming is not just about having fun ...Oct 18, 2023 · What is the difference between performance management and performance appraisals? Performance appraisal is the individual session between the employee and the manager. This often happens (bi-)annually. Performance management is a periodic, systematic, and objective process of developing an employee to perform their job to the best of their ability. A performance management system monitors and tracks employees’ job performance consistently and accurately. By leveraging a combination of technologies and methodologies, the system ensures that employees are aligned with the business’s strategic objectives and make valuable contributions towards them. The performance management process lets employees document and discuss their performance with their manager. In turn, managers can provide feedback and guidance to the employees. Besides choosing the best investment, you must track the performance of your mutual funds to know how you can grow your inve...DCPAS manages the DOD Performance Management and Appraisal Program (DPMAP), a performance management system which covers the majority of DOD employees. DPMAP utilizes a process for planning, monitoring, evaluating, and recognizing employee performance while linking individual employee performance to organizational goals.
